#3e4c37 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e4c37 is composed of 24.3% red, 29.8%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.6%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 100 degrees, a saturation of 16% and a lightness of 25.7%. #3e4c37 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c986e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#3e4c37 color description : Very dark grayish green.
#3e4c37 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e4c37 has RGB values of R:62, G:76,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 4082743.
